Short Summery about Virtual Power Plant (VPP) Market

The global Virtual Power Plant (VPP) market size was valued at USD 935.05 million in 2021 and is expected to expand at a CAGR of 24.13% during the forecast period, reaching USD 3421.17 million by 2027.
